The rise of edge sensor solutions marks a major shift in data acquisition and processing strategies. By enabling data processing at the sensor level, edge solutions reduce the need for centralized computation.

The strength of edge sensors lies in their real-time operational solutions analysis capabilities. These systems allow machines and users to respond to conditions as they happen, not after delays caused by cloud transmission. With reduced lag, systems operate more efficiently and can avoid costly downtime.

Another benefit of edge sensor systems is their role in minimizing unnecessary data transmission. By pre-processing data locally, these sensors lower the load on network infrastructure. This not only conserves bandwidth but also helps lower overall data storage and transmission costs.

One of the lesser-known but powerful benefits of edge sensors is improved privacy protection. Processing sensitive data locally reduces the risk of exposure during transmission to external servers. Industries handling personal or mission-critical data can trust edge sensors for more secure operations.

Factories and plants rely on edge sensors to monitor equipment and anticipate maintenance needs. Vibration, temperature, and pressure data collected at the edge can signal potential issues before they become critical. Predictive analytics supported by edge sensors leads to more efficient maintenance cycles.

Edge sensor technologies are also a major component of smart cities and connected infrastructure. They monitor air quality, traffic flow, utility usage, and structural health in real time. This improves responsiveness and helps municipalities better serve residents and reduce environmental impact.

In the realm of agriculture, edge sensor solutions enhance precision farming techniques. This leads to increased yields, reduced environmental impact, and lower operational costs. Edge technology enables smart farming even in regions with limited access to cloud services.
